EasyJet buys Aer Berlin's operations at Tegel

The EasyJet deal will see it operating 25 aircraft from Berlin Tegel Airport

Budget airline EasyJet has partly acquired Air Berlin operations at Berlin Tegel Airport. 

The €40m deal includes some of Air Berlin's operations at Tegel airport, leases for up to 25 A320 aircraft and about 1,000 of Air Berlin's pilots and cabin crew. 

It will make EasyJet the largest carrier in the German capital. 

The airline currently flies from Berlin Schoenefeld airport to destinations outside Germany. The deal will allow it to move into the larger inner-city Tegel airport. 

The British company was expected to confirm the acquisition after it gained unconditional EU competiton approval last week.

Air Berlin filed for insolvency in August and is being carved up among several buyers.
